Dr Andy Williams

Dr Andy Williams 

Andy is the Director of the Centre for Outdoor Education Studies at Trinity College, University of Wales. He has been involved with outdoor and experiential learning for over twenty five years and has taught in higher education in Australia and the UK. He has travelled and taken part in expeditions throughout the world including Scandanavia, New Zealand, Australia, Russia, China, Nepal, South Pacific islands, North America, and Antarctica.

Andy is an Accredited Practitioner of the Institute for Outdoor Learning and uses the outdoor learning environment as a setting for personal development, community regeneration and management training programmes. has worked with a broad range of client groups including young people, children, higher education students, adults returning to work, special needs, management, ethnic minorities and youth at risk. He is a highly respected commentator on outdoor and experiential learning and a regular contributor to international publications and conferences on outdoor learning and retains an active coaching role in mountaineering, rock climbing, kayaking, and caving.
